Is PAW WATRES Water Safe to Drink?
PAW WATRES has reported 2 contaminants above EPA health-based guidelines (MCLGs) in at least one city served. We recommend reviewing individual city reports below for specific water quality details.
This utility serves 52,002 people across 17 cities in PA. Water quality can vary by location within the service area. Check individual city pages below for detailed contaminant data specific to your area.
